Overview

This position is responsible for the overall management and coordination of tasks associated with the high functioning of the medical education program related to Phase 1 of the curriculum. This position will work collaboratively with the members of the UME Office, Education Technology, the Office of Assessment and Evaluation, as well as module, course, Phase 1 directors, program administrators, and students. 

Responsibilities

Overall administrative support for the Assistant Dean of Basic Sciences and Phase 1 Co-Directors, including: 

  • Management of the SOM Year 1 and Year 2 homepages on the learning management system 
  • Schedule meetings as required to support Phase 1 curriculum delivery 
  • Quarterly module director meetings 
  • Module specific planning meetings for module planning and implementation 
  • Other meetings as required

Support Phase 1 directors, module directors, including Intersession Director, in curriculum delivery and administration, including: 

  • Preparing curricular material as requested by module directors 
  • Assisting module directors with organization and coordination of teaching schedules 
  • Managing space reservations for all educational sessions and placing information in campus resource scheduler 
  • Communicating with teaching faculty regarding schedules 
  • Maintaining up-to-date teaching faculty information 
  • Uploading curricular material into the learning management system 
  • Monitor annual faculty attestation completion 
  • Other duties as requested 

Provide central oversight and ongoing monitoring of required course evaluations and assessments in learning management system, ensuring compliance with policy 

  • Review student grade reports in learning management system and ensure reports are complete and that narrative comments, where required, are included and comply with institutional policy 
  • Ensure student grade reports are forwarded to the Registrar's Office and uploaded to the students’ portfolio in compliance with institutional policy 
  • Create monthly reports on grade submission for courses to ensure compliance with accreditation requirements 
  • Tracking and monitoring student attendance and absence across Phase 1 
  • Tracking and monitoring Professionalism behaviors across Phase 1 
  • Assist Ed Tech in coordinating and administering computer-based assessments. 
  • Serve as examination proctor when required 

Support Chair of Phase 1 Curriculum Subcommittee 

  • Compile agenda and distribute materials for monthly meetings 
  • Record and document minutes for monthly meetings 
  • Monitor annual attestation completion 

Provide general office support to the UME Office, including: 

  • Greeting visitors to the UME Office 
  • Monitoring and answering emails and phones and triaging to appropriate individuals 
  • Schedule meetings as requested 
  • Support for curricular programs managed through the UME office (e.g., Transition Course, Intersessions) 
  • Additional administrative tasks of the UME office as needed 

Qualifications

Education requirement:

  • Bachelor’s degree 

Technical/computer skills:

  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ite, Outlook, Word, Excel and PowerPoint  
  • Agility in learning new computer applications 
  • Experience with online learning management systems preferred 

 Prior experience:

  • 3-5 Years in higher education administration
